Directions
- Make several shallow slashes in the skinless side of the salmon filets. Place filets skin-side down in a glass baking dish.
- In a bowl, whisk together the olive oil, rice wine vinegar, so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ic, pepper, onion, and sesame oil. Pour the mixture over the salmon, cover, and refrigerate for 1 to 2 hours.
- Preheat the oven to 350°F.
- In a medium saucepan, combine the rice, dill, and water according to rice package directions. Bring to a boil, then cook over medium-low heat until the rice is tender and the water has been absorbed, about 20 minutes.
- Remove cover from salmon, and bake in the marinating dish for about 30 minutes, or until fish flakes easily with a fork.
- Serve the salmon over the rice, and pour sauce over.
